How Multi-level Car Garage Functions and The Benefits
Multi-level vehicle parking systems offer a compact method for urban locations . Essentially, they utilize a robotic setup to raise vehicles skyward between multiple levels . Users typically position their auto onto a pallet which is then conveyed to an available spot . Such a arrangement significantly minimizes the size required compared to conventional parking areas , supplying more garage room in a smaller space. Apart from the footprint-reducing aspect , multi-level auto storage can also boost traffic movement and develop a better visual appearance within a downtown area.
